Transaction bc686805e57023bf06547e47b9ace31131998b0c768b7404feacf0509b1e518e
1 Input
1 Output
-
bc686805e57023bf06547e47b9ace31131998b0c768b7404feacf0509b1e518e:0
- value
- 9520784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 754c84ad1c26e20b5d3c987d03eaf4a01747447e OP_EQUAL
- address
- 3CPEea2eWUmVGKprCNCq4913jNTWHFye77